TR24207Participant‘Guilty white liberals’ are viewed with suspicion because their empathy is perceived as being something more akin to pity, and their efforts are viewed as patronizing in some situations. ‘Guilty white liberals’ are the ones who help organize protests against instances of institutionalized racism or other crimes, but then take on the role as spokespeople for the ‘poor, helpless oppressed people,’ making the people they’re advocating feel powerless and resentful. In addition, because they see themselves as the good guys, it’s hard to tell the ‘guilty white liberals’ to back off a little and let someone else speak. I don’t know if ‘guilty white liberals’ actually exist, but some people are viewed as such and thus fulfill this role, to the chagrin of others.
